Part Time Fragrance & Beauty Sales Consultant
Location: John Lewis Oxford
Contract
:
Permanent, 22.5 hours/week, any 3 in 7 days
CHANEL is an independent company that believes in the freedom of creation, cultivates human potential, and acts to have a positive impact in the world.
"In order to be irreplaceable, one must always be different" stated company founder, Gabrielle Chanel. At CHANEL, we strive to identify what is unique in each person and support them through their journey with the brand.
Our mission at CHANEL Beauty is to underline what is most unique in every person and give our clients the confidence to become the true expression of themselves through exceptional fragrance, makeup and skincare creations.
Your role @CHANEL:
As a Fragrance & Beauty Sales Consultant, you are the ultimate CHANEL ambassador and you will play a key role in our mission, embodying our values and DNA.
Leveraging your experience, CHANEL will enable you to:
- Demonstrate your passion and knowledge in Fragrance, Makeup and Skincare
- Create a unique and personalised experience for our clients which is authentic and tailored to their personal needs
- Ensure excellence in client service in accordance with CHANEL's rituals and standards
- Build and develop long lasting relationships to recruit, retain and increase client loyalty
- Contribute to the sales performance by leveraging all different levers that you will be provided with (products, services, clienteling tools, events, etc.) and develop cross-selling among all categories
- Uphold an omni-channel mindset to directly benefit the client, producing a seamless experience from in-store to online and vice versa
- Be part of a collaborative and inclusive community to achieve individual and collective goals

Benefits at CHANEL:
Our employee benefits have been created to support you across your professional and personal life by offering you:
- Physical Wellbeing: Private Medical Insurance covering pre-existing medical conditions and ability to add family members, Online GP App with 24/7 appointments available within 24 hours and Cycle Scheme participation for a tax-exempt bike and/or accessories.
- Financial Wellbeing: Pension, Life Assurance and Retail Discounts across multiple retailers including Supermarkets, Gyms, Days Out and 100's more.
- Mental Wellbeing: Employee Assistance Programmes and Other Support Lines.
- Lifestyle: Arts & Culture Ticket Discounts across major London attractions, CHANEL Product Discounts and Employee Only Sales.
- Employee Recognition: Service Awards Programme offering CHANEL Products, Retail Vouchers and Additional Holidays across milestones.
- Benefits are eligibility dependant and subject to change at any time
